Subject:   Booting from Drive 1
Message-ID:  <323053A1.25A1@infi.net>

next in thread | raw e-mail | index | archive | help
I have 2.1.5 installed on a a SCSI and MSDos on the MB EIDE. I am 
using BootEasy at the boot manager.  When booting FreeBSD I have to 
type in the boot specification of 1:sd(0,a)kernel or it fails doing
a chroot at the end of loading.  Is there a way to fix this without
reinstalling?  If I do have to reinstall, what do I have to do to get
it working properly?
